Police are appealing for information after a teenager was assaulted in Baildon.
The incident took place in the Buck Lane area at about 4.30pm on Tuesday 4 September. The victim, a 15-year-old girl, was shaken but unhurt. The incident is alleged to have involved a white male of similar age who may have followed her from the railway station.
A crime of assault has been recorded in relation to the matter and is being investigated by Bradford District CID.
